** Shares of Vertiv Holdings VRT.N down ~10% to $82.37 after Barclays analysts slashed their price target on the data center technology provider
** VRT is on track for biggest daily pct decline since Jan. 27
** "We are concerned that Q1 orders, when taken in conjunction with the orders rates of recent quarters, will not be supportive of bulls' hopes for a high teens/20%+ sales growth
rate in 2026," said Barclays analysts led by Julian Mitchell
** "2025 EPS guidance can likely come up due to FX tailwinds and the organic sales backlog entering the year," Mitchell added
** Barclays cut VRT PT to $100 from $111 but retained "equal weight" rating
** Among 22 analysts covering VRT, the avg rating is "BUY" and median PT is $139.50
** VRT is down ~28% YTD vs ~10% drop in S&P 500 technology index .SPLRCT
